Boston Celtics: Joe Mazzulla sidelined at tipoff due to an eye injury

Boston Celtics interim head coach Joe Mazzulla was sidelined moments before tipoff due to an apparent eye irritation, as the team called it, forcing assistant coach Damon Stoudamire to hold head coaching duties tonight against Houston.

The irritation in Mazzulla’s eye was noticed during his pregame press conference where he was noticeably squinting and rubbing his right eye.

The Celtics haven’t provided any further details about the status of Mazzulla’s injury, as it’s still unsure if he’ll miss additional time or not.

Boston has one more game left in 2022 on Thursday night against the Los Angeles Clippers.
